Nabil wrote:
> I am in the process of choosing between RAW devices or QFS (Sun Cluster
> 3.1/Solaris 9) to support a busy online transactional Oracle RAC 10g
> application (2 nodes).
>
> I want to know of any QFS drawbacks or performance issues. Again, this
> will be a very busy online transactional system supporting in excess of
> 3000 concurrent users.
>
> I would like to hear from anyone with a similar setup.
>
> Nabil Courdy
> ==========

The primary drawback to Sun Cluster is you are paying for something that is of zero value. In Oracle 10g all clusterware is provided by Oracle and included in your RAC license.

That said ... the best solution depends on your storage vendor and devices which you didn't mention.
